多重签名技术的作用与应用解析
随着数字货币和区块链技术的迅速发展,多重签名技术成为了保障用户资产安全的重要手段。多重签名(Multi-Signature,简称多签)是一种特殊的数字签名协议,允许多个用户共同控制一个钱包或账户。该技术的出现,大大增强了数字资产的安全性,降低了单点故障的风险,推动了去中心化金融(DeFi)的进一步发展。以下将详细探讨多重签名的作用及其应用,并针对相关问题做深入分析。
一、多重签名的基本概念
多重签名的基本概念是通过要求多个参与者共同签署一笔交易,来提高资产的安全性。传统的数字钱包通常只配备一个私钥,而多重签名钱包则通过设定多个私钥来实现安全控制。例如,可以设定一个钱包需要3个私钥中的2个才能授权交易,这样即使一个私钥被盗,攻击者仍无法完成交易。
这种机制广泛应用于数字货币交易、资产管理、智能合约等场景,提升了安全保障,降低了资产丢失的风险。同时,多重签名还提升了交易透明度和信任度,因为所有签署方均需参与交易的批准。
二、多重签名的主要作用
1. 提高安全性
多重签名的核心优势在于提升账户的安全性。相比于单一私钥控制的账户,多重签名通过要求多个签名,显著提高了盗窃和资金滥用的难度。即便黑客能够获取其中一个私钥,也无法独立完成交易。这为企业和个人提供了一种更为安全的数据保护手段,能够有效防范黑客攻击和内部腐败。
2. 风险分散
在多重签名体系中,用户可以选择不同的签署者,包括多个公司高管、不同部门甚至外部审计师。这样,即使某个签署者拒绝合作或丢失了私钥,其他签署者仍然可以继续完成交易,确保资金的安全流动。这种分散控制的形式不仅减少了单点故障的风险,还增强了交易决策的合规性。
3. 增强透明度
多重签名的实现过程是公开透明的,所有参与方都可以查看所有的签名情况,这为合规审计提供了便利。对于涉及多个利益相关者的交易,任何一方都可以要求查看和审核签名记录,增强了信任。在对企业内部和外部经济活动进行审计时,透明度的提升可以有效降低舞弊风险。
4. 灵活的交易管理
多重签名不仅在安全性上具备优势,其灵活性也是显而易见的。用户可以自由设置需要几签中的多少签名才能完成交易,制定不同的签署规则。此外,企业还可以根据实际需要和不同的场景来调整签署者。这种灵活性使得多重签名适用于多种不同的商业模式和运营策略。
5. 促进合作与决策
多重签名的存在促进了决策过程中的团队合作。比如,在一次资金分配中,多重签名能确保各方共同参与和批准交易。这种机制鼓励团队成员之间进行有效的沟通与合作,确保所有参与者在决策过程中都有声音,有利于达成共识。
三、多重签名的应用场景
1. 数字资产钱包
多重签名在数字资产钱包中的应用非常广泛,尤其是对大额资金的管理。企业和个人可以选择将资产存放在多重签名钱包中,仅通过多个私钥的共同签名来完成交易,这样可以有效降低资产被盗及误操作的风险。在实际操作中,许多数字货币交易所和钱包服务商都已采用多重签名技术来提高安全性。
2. 企业资产管理
对于大型企业,多重签名是资产管理中不可或缺的工具。企业可以设定多个高管的私钥来管理公司的资金流动,确保资金的支出和转移都经过必要的审核和批准。这种管理方式不仅提升了资金安全性,还提高了合规程度,有助于防范财务风险。
3. 去中心化金融(DeFi)应用
在DeFi领域,多重签名也得到了广泛应用。许多去中心化协议与项目采用多重签名来管理资金池和合约,确保团队和社区成员的资金安全。在这种模式下,投资者的资金不再掌握在单一团队手中,而是在多个信任的参与者之间分散管理,提升了透明度与安全性。
4. 保险和遗产规划
多重签名在保险和遗产规划中也展现了其重要价值。用户可以设定特定的受益人和审核者,确保在特定条件下资金被正确分配。这种方法既能保护资金的安全,又能确保遗产规划的透明和有效执行。
5. 社区治理
在社区治理领域,尤其是区块链项目中,多重签名被作为重要的治理工具。项目的决策通常需要社区成员的共同签署才能形成有效的决策,确保社区参与的透明度与公平性。这种治理模式通过多重签名提高了参与者之间的信任,促进项目的良性发展。
四、可能相关的问题
多重签名如何提升数字钱包的安全性?
多重签名在数字钱包中的具体应用和提升安全性的方式主要体现在以下几个方面:
首先,多重签名通过要求多个独立的私钥来共同完成一笔交易,显著提高了交易的安全性。在传统的单私钥系统中,一旦私钥被盗,攻击者就可以独立操作钱包中的资产。然而,在多重签名系统中,即便攻击者盗取了其中一个私钥,还是无法完成交易,因为还需要其他私钥的共同签署。这样有效降低了黑客成功实施攻击的概率。
其次,多重签名允许用户设置签名规则,比如可以设定“2-of-3”或“3-of-5”签名规则。在这种情况下,即使有一个私钥被泄露,只要攻击者无法获取其他密钥,资产依然处于安全状态。这样可以在一定程度上防范内部员工的恶意行为或意外失误。
最后,多重签名还为账户冻结提供了机制支持。如果一个钱包的私钥丢失或出现异常,管理团队可以临时冻结账户,防止资金流失。同时,正常的交易依然可以通过其他签名者的授权来继续执行,从而减轻单一私钥丢失造成的潜在风险。
在企业中如何有效实施多重签名?
企业在实施多重签名时,需要考虑多个方面,包括角色设定、签名规则、以及合规审计等。
首先,企业需明确签名者的角色和权限,哪些员工或高管具备签字权,如何确保这些角色的透明度。在进行角色设定时,建议采用“最小权限”原则,避免不必要的权限滥用,确保签署者只拥有完成其工作所需的权限。
其次,企业还需设定合理的签名规则。例如,可以根据资金流动的大小或类型来设定不同级别的签名要求,对于大额支付可能需要更多成员的批准,这样不仅能提升交易的安全性,还能降低财务风险。
最后,合规审计是多重签名实施的另一重要方面。企业应定期对多重签名的使用情况进行审计,以确保所有交易都是经过适当授权并符合公司政策的。这种透明度对于维护内部流程高效和符合规定至关重要,可以有效预防内部舞弊或财务数据造假。
多重签名在去中心化金融(DeFi)中的应用有哪些挑战?
尽管多重签名在DeFi中具有显著优势,但是也面临着不少挑战。首先是用户体验,现有的多重签名解决方案通常对用户的操作复杂度提出了要求,可能导致用户的学习成本增高。在某些情况下,用户可能因为不熟悉多重签名操作而放弃使用,减缓其推广速度。
其次,安全性依然是一个问题。虽然多重签名比单个私钥系统更安全,但一旦所有签名者的安全措施不够严谨(如同一门密码),可能导致整体安全性降低。因此,DeFi项目需要在多重签名实施时,制定严格的安全规范和要求,确保每个参与方的私钥都得到妥善保护。
第三,合规性也是一项挑战。多重签名的使用常常涉及到法律合规方面的问题,特别是在跨国操作时。不同地区对数字资产的监管规定各异,企业和项目需要确保其多重签名系统符合当地法律规定,以防法律风险。
如何选择合适的多重签名算法?
选择合适的多重签名算法对企业及项目的安全至关重要。首先,应评估不同算法的安全性,确保所选算法经过了充分的审计和验证。如ECDSA、EdDSA等算法均具备一定的安全性,企业可根据用户需求和成本选择合适的算法。
其次,选择便捷性也是关键。企业和用户希望在保证安全的前提下,采用易于操作的算法和工具。市面上有很多多重签名钱包的软件及协议,用户可以测试不同产品以寻找最适合其需求的解决方案。
最后,综合考虑社区支持和生态系统的成熟度。目前一些流行的多重签名协议(如Gnosis Safe)在社区支持上较为成熟,有丰富的文档和社区讨论,选择这样的协议可以减少实现过程中的学习调整成本。
多重签名对智能合约的影响是什么?
多重签名对智能合约的影响体现在多个方面。首先,多重签名可以提升智能合约的安全性,尤其是在涉及多个签署方的合约执行中。当智能合约中的关键操作需要多方签署时,使用多重签名可以有效降低安全风险,确保每个链上的操作都经过授权。
其次,合同执行的透明度和可审计性也会得到提升。所有签署方的操作记录都将被永久地记录在区块链上,任何一方都可以随时追溯和审计交易过程。这种透明特性使得合约执行过程中的争议更容易得到解决。
另外,由于智能合约的自动化特性与多重签名的灵活性相结合,企业能够设定复杂的业务规则,确保用户在满足特定条件下才能执行合约。这种灵活性不仅为合约提供了如同法律效应的保障,还增强了用户信任感。
最后,结合多重签名和 DAO(去中心化自治组织)也将推动智能合约的发展与认知。越来越多的DAO通过多重签名来管理基金和决策,使得参与者共同治理。这种新型治理模式对企业结构和管理模式产生了深远影响,推动了去中心化经济的进一步发展。
总的来说,多重签名作为一种重要的安全机制,为数字资产、企业管理、去中心化金融等多个领域提供了有效的支持。随着技术的不断发展,未来多重签名的应用场景和解决方案无疑会更加丰富多样。企业和个人如能充分了解和应用这一技术,将能够有效提升其资产管理及安全能力。